Industrial zones release many invisible particles into the air. These chemicals float through the breeze every single day. They eventually land on your shiny vehicle surface. The air contains heavy metals and sulfur compounds. These pollutants react with the moisture in the clouds. Acid rain then falls onto your clear coat. This process begins the slow destruction of paint. Modern finishes look strong but remain quite porous. Microscopic gaps allow harmful gases to enter deeply. Owners must understand these environmental threats very well. Proper care prevents permanent damage to your investment.
The Chemical Reaction Process
Now the sun heats up the metal panels. This heat accelerates the chemical reaction on surfaces. Pollutants sit on the top layer of paint. Oxygen reacts with these settled industrial dust particles. This bond creates a dull and chalky appearance. The vibrant color fades under this constant pressure. Sometimes the paint begins to flake off completely. You might see small white spots on hoods. Industrial Fallout Impact
So the local factories emit various soot particles. These jagged flakes scratch the delicate clear coat. Wind pushes the grime into the paint pores. Rain then traps the grit inside the finish. The surface feels rough like coarse sandpaper now. Washing alone cannot remove these embedded metal bits. Specialized tools must pull the contaminants out safely. Protection Against Oxidation
The best defense involves a strong physical barrier. High quality wax blocks the harsh acidic air. You should apply a sealant every few months. This coating prevents oxygen from reaching the pigment. Restoration of Damaged Surfaces
But some vehicles already show signs of fading. Professional polishing removes the dead layer of paint. This process reveals the fresh color underneath it. Technicians use fine abrasives to level the surface. The light reflects evenly off the smooth finish. Now the car shines like the first day. Deep scratches require more intensive labor and care.
